Output dd004e160c16750fdbcfa6c70799f94621e243f90e5d804d54948f603d3e0166:0

value
40475649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30bd367908667e20f6712819321cad3915d93f6a OP_EQUAL
address
368j2VAKZswyMNhNBPPQ14iAxFfTueSz4f
transaction
dd004e160c16750fdbcfa6c70799f94621e243f90e5d804d54948f603d3e0166
spent
true